Synopsis "Haunting Near Virtuous Spring (in English)"

Mill Circle has been a favorite haunt for 200 years for residents and visitors. A lost poem written in 1861 sparked research that uncovered tales of a mineral spring, an alleged murder, ghosts, a legendary haunted house, malicious destruction of cultural heritage, and even the Titanic disaster, all centering on one neighborhood's social history. Two victims of the infamous maritime disaster were born in Winchendon Springs.Dr. William Russo puts together this collection of history and images, based on his unique view to the historic Mill Circle neighborhood. A biography of Mill Circle emerges from these pages. Included is a summary of the history of the Virtuous Spring that was the center of Mill Circle in Winchendon, Massachusetts. Part ghost story and part murder tale, with a rediscovered 19th century poem at its core, HAUNTING AT VIRTUOUS SPRING looks at an atypical neighborhood from its colonial days to the present time. Wealthy and poor, healthy and sick, all came together on this street for over two and a half centuries.Includes nearly 100 photographs, dozens in color-and many rare pictures, with some never seen by the public.We gratefully acknowledge the Winchendon Historical Society for all its help.
